@import"https://fonts.googleapis.com/css2?family=Caveat:wght@400..700&display=swap";input[type=number]{-webkit-appearance:none;-moz-appearance:none;appearance:none;text-align:center;font-size:18px;padding:2px}input[type=range]{-webkit-appearance:none;-moz-appearance:none;appearance:none;width:100%;height:20px;cursor:pointer;outline:none;overflow:hidden;border-radius:16px}input[type=range]::-webkit-slider-runnable-track{height:20px;background:#4645458f}input[type=range]::-webkit-slider-thumb{-webkit-appearance:none;-moz-appearance:none;appearance:none;height:20px;width:20px;border:2px solid #fefef6ac;border-radius:50%;box-shadow:-350px 0 0 340px var(--bg-color);background:linear-gradient(0deg,#2c3e50,#9b9b9b)}input[type=checkbox]{-webkit-appearance:none;-moz-appearance:none;appearance:none;margin:0;display:grid;place-content:center;font-size:inherit;background-color:#9c9c98;outline:none;width:2.5em;height:4.5em;border:.1em solid var(--main-color)}input[type=checkbox]:before{content:"";background-color:var(--main-color);width:2em;height:3.5em;transform:scale(0);transition:.12s transform ease}input[type=checkbox]:checked:before{transform:scale(1);background-color:var(--bg-color)}:root{--main-color: #404041;--bg-color: #f6ede3;--border-color: #e1e1e1}*{margin:0;padding:0;box-sizing:border-box}body{display:flex;align-items:center;justify-content:center;height:100vh;background-color:var(--bg-color);background-repeat:no-repeat;background-size:cover;font-family:Caveat,sans-serif}.steps{display:flex}.steps>*:nth-child(4n):not(:last-child){margin-right:10px}button{border:none}.drum{display:flex;background-color:var(--main-color);padding:20px;gap:20px}.drum-left{display:flex;flex-direction:column;justify-content:space-around}.volume{display:flex;align-items:center;gap:10px}button{border:none;background-color:transparent;border-radius:50%;cursor:pointer;outline:none}.top{display:flex;gap:2.5rem;align-items:center;background-color:var(--main-color);padding:30px;border-bottom:1px solid #000}.controller{gap:10px;display:flex;align-items:center;justify-content:center}.btn{background:linear-gradient(0deg,#2c3e50,#9b9b9b);box-shadow:inset 0 1px 1px #696969,0 5px 5px #040404;padding:8px;position:relative;color:#eee;display:flex}.btn-pressed{background:linear-gradient(0deg,#2c3e50,#9b9b9b);box-shadow:inset 0 0 #000,inset 0 0 3px 1px #000}.icon{color:#fff;margin-top:8px;font-size:25px}
